ip定位是啥(ip定位是什么原理)

IP定位是一种通过IP地址来确定用户地理位置的技术。以下是关于IP定位原理的详细介绍。

一、IP定位的定义及意义

IP定位是指通过分析IP地址,推断出用户所在的大致地理位置ip定位是啥(ip定位是什么原理)。这种技术对于网站运营、网络安全、广告推广等方面具有重要意义。通过IP定位,企业可以更好地了解用户分布,针对性地推送内容,提高用户体验。

二、IP定位的原理

1. IP地址分配规则:IP地址由四个数字组成,每个数字介于0-255之间。根据IP地址的分配规则,不同的IP地址段对应着不同的地理位置。
2. 路由器追踪:当用户访问一个网站时,请求会经过多个路由器。每个路由器都会记录下请求的源IP地址和目标IP地址。通过分析这些路由器的日志,可以推断出用户所在的大致位置。
3. 数据库匹配:IP定位系统中,有一个庞大的IP地址与地理位置的对应数据库。当系统收到一个IP地址时,会在数据库中查找与之对应的地理位置信息。
4. 算法优化:为了提高定位精度,IP定位系统会采用各种算法对结果进行优化,如插值算法、近邻算法等。

三、IP定位的准确性及局限性

1. 准确性:IP定位通常能到城市级别,但受到网络运营商、路由器配置等因素的影响,准确性可能会有所下降。
2. 局限性:IP定位并非百分百准确,对于使用VPN、代理服务器等情况,定位结果可能存在偏差。此外,随着IPv6的普及,IP地址数量暴增,定位准确性也将受到影响。
相关问
问:IP定位为什么能到城市级别?
IP地址分配规则与地理位置有很大关系,不同的IP地址段对应着不同的地理位置。此外,IP定位系统中的数据库会记录大量的IP地址与地理位置的对应关系,从而提高定位精度。
问:为什么有时候IP定位结果不准确?
IP定位结果可能受到以下因素的影响:网络运营商、路由器配置、使用VPN或代理服务器、IPv6地址分配等。这些因素可能导致定位结果存在偏差。

ip66.net

© 版权声明

相关文章

暂无评论

none
暂无评论...